What Makes a Good Roboter Name?

When it comes to naming robots, several factors come into play. A good roboter name should be memorable, easy to pronounce, and reflective of the robot's purpose. Here are some essential aspects to consider:

  • Functionality: The name should hint at what the robot does. For example, a cleaning robot might be named "Dusty."
  • Personality: Names can imbue robots with character traits. Names like "Buddy" or "RoboChef" can make them seem more approachable.
  • Branding: Companies often create names that align with their brand identity, fostering recognition and loyalty.
  • Cultural Relevance: A name that resonates with a specific audience can enhance acceptance and user experience.

Are There Famous Robots with Unique Names?

Indeed, there are numerous robots that have made headlines, thanks in part to their distinct names. Some famous examples include:

  • R2-D2: The beloved astromech droid from the "Star Wars" franchise.
  • Optimus Prime: The leader of the Autobots in "Transformers," known for his noble spirit.
  • ASIMO: Honda's humanoid robot known for its advanced mobility and intelligence.
  • Atlas: Boston Dynamics' humanoid robot that can perform complex tasks.

What Role Does Naming Play in Human-Robot Interaction?

The name of a robot can significantly influence how users perceive and interact with it. Studies have shown that robots with human-like names often foster a stronger emotional connection with users. This connection can lead to increased trust and a willingness to accept robots in various settings, from homes to workplaces.

What Are the Trends in Roboter Naming?

As technology evolves, so do naming conventions in robotics. Current trends include:

- Names inspired by mythology or history (e.g., "Prometheus" for a fire-fighting robot). - Use of abbreviations or acronyms (e.g., "ROV" for remotely operated vehicles). - Incorporation of tech terms or slang (e.g., "Bot" or "Droid").

Can Roboter Names Impact Public Perception of Technology?

Absolutely! The name given to a robot can shape public perception and acceptance of emerging technologies. For instance, a robot named "CareBot" may elicit a sense of comfort and safety, making it more likely to be welcomed into healthcare settings.

What Are Some Notable Roboter Names in Pop Culture?

Pop culture has given rise to many iconic roboter names that resonate with audiences. Some noteworthy examples include:

- Wall-E: The lovable waste-collecting robot from Pixar's film, symbolizing environmental awareness. - Data: The android from "Star Trek," known for his quest to understand humanity. - Marvin: The depressed robot from "The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y," known for his wit and humor.

How Do Different Cultures Approach Roboter Naming?

Different cultures have unique perspectives on naming robots. For example:

- In Japan, robots are often given names that reflect their friendly nature, like "Pepper." - In Western cultures, names may lean towards more functional or technical descriptors, such as "RoboVac." - Some cultures may incorporate traditional or historical figures into robot names, linking technology with heritage.
